One of the greatest advantages of aluminum conductor technology is its excellent strength-to-weight ratio. Compared with heavier conductor materials, aluminum offers exceptional conductivity while significantly reducing overall weight. This lightweight characteristic simplifies transportation, installation, and maintenance while decreasing the structural load placed on transmission towers and supporting hardware. The result is improved installation efficiency and reduced project costs without sacrificing electrical performance.
Durability is another defining characteristic of professionally manufactured aluminum conductor products. Outdoor transmission systems operate continuously under exposure to sunlight, rain, humidity, wind, temperature fluctuations, industrial pollution, and harsh environmental conditions. High-quality aluminum materials provide excellent resistance against corrosion and oxidation, helping preserve electrical performance throughout years of operation. These protective characteristics reduce maintenance requirements while extending service life and improving overall network reliability.
